> I once suggested to someone that they try taking Trileptal at a constant dosage during the clonazepam withdrawal period. He reported that it worked very well. I later found that my idea was not unique.
>
> http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/18821451
>
> You could try taking a low dosage of Trileptal first; perhaps 200 - 400 mg/day. However, you may need 600 mg/day or more. You might want to begin Trileptal treatment before tapering the clonazepam. Clonazepam seems to be a particularly difficult BZD to discontinue. I'm not sure why. It may have something to do with its unique serotonergic properties. There is, of course, the strategy of crossing-over to Valium and tapering the dosage from there. I would be curious to see how Neurontin works.
>
>
> - Scott

I used Lyrica once during a fast taper, worked well. Unfortunately the anxiolytic properties of Lyrica disappeared after two weeks. So it was back to clonazepam. That's the drawback with a fast taper, the brain doesn't have time to adjust and is in a super-tense state. At least that's what it feels like.
